npm 是前端开发中常用的包管理工具,可以方便地获取、安装和管理依赖包。fourcels-npm-demo 是一款基于 npm 的开源工具包,旨在提供一些实用的 JS 工具函数,帮助开发者更轻松地完成项目开发。本文将详细介绍 fourcels-npm-demo 的使用方法及示例。
安装
打开终端,进入项目根目录,通过以下命令安装 fourcels-npm-demo:
npm install fourcels-npm-demo
使用
在项目中引入 fourcels-npm-demo:
import { formatDate } from 'fourcels-npm-demo'
使用 formatDate 函数进行日期格式化:
const date = new Date() const formattedDate = formatDate(date, 'yyyy-MM-dd HH:mm:ss') console.log(formattedDate) // "2021-01-01 12:00:00"
fourcels-npm-demo 还包含了其他实用的函数,具体介绍如下:
1. formatDate
格式化日期字符串。
import { formatDate } from 'fourcels-npm-demo' const date = new Date() const formattedDate = formatDate(date, 'yyyy-MM-dd HH:mm:ss') console.log(formattedDate) // "2021-01-01 12:00:00"
2. generateRandomNumber
生成指定区间的随机数。
import { generateRandomNumber } from 'fourcels-npm-demo' const randomNum = generateRandomNumber(1, 100) console.log(randomNum) // 57
3. capitalize
将字符串首字母大写。
import { capitalize } from 'fourcels-npm-demo' const str = 'hello world' const capitalizedStr = capitalize(str) console.log(capitalizedStr) // "Hello world"
4. getQueryParameters
获取 URL 中的参数对象。
import { getQueryParameters } from 'fourcels-npm-demo' const url = 'http://localhost:3000?name=John&age=20' const params = getQueryParameters(url) console.log(params) // { name: 'John', age: '20' }
高级用法
fourcels-npm-demo 还提供了一些高级用法,可以更加灵活地使用。例如,可以将 formatDate 作为一个管道函数使用:
import { formatDate } from 'fourcels-npm-demo' const formatDatePipe = (date, format) => formatDate(date, format) const date = new Date() const formattedDate = date |> formatDatePipe('yyyy-MM-dd HH:mm:ss') console.log(formattedDate) // "2021-01-01 12:00:00"
总结
fourcels-npm-demo 是一款实用的 JS 工具包,提供了多个常用函数,可以帮助我们更加轻松地完成项目开发。本文介绍了 fourcels-npm-demo 的安装、使用及部分高级用法,希望能够对读者有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055fa981e8991b448dcfbc